Do Porches Require Planning Permission? At the time of writing this post, you shouldn't need to apply for planning permission for a porch in Ballingry if no element of the porch is over 3m above ground level, the exterior floor area isn't more than 3m2, no part of the porch construction is within 2 metres from the boundary of the property on which it is being built or within 2m of any road, your residence is a house, not a maisonette, flat or other kind of building.

It's always a good idea to have a chat with your local planning office before pressing ahead with your porch. Ask your chosen Ballingry porch builder to help you out with this procedure. If in doubt, check!

Porch Building Ballingry (KY5)

Building Regulations: Don't forget that building regulations are different from planning permission. Where porches are involved you WILL need building regulations approval unless the exterior door is not taken out, any current disabled access is maintained and the porch construction is below 30 square metres and is at ground level. Approval is invariably needed for certain windows and all electrical installations.

Porch Canopies Ballingry

Overdoor canopies, also known as porch canopies, are roof-like structures typically attached to the exterior wall above a doorway or entrance. Porch and overdoor canopies aren't just about appearance! They boast both functional benefits and aesthetic appeal. With an assortment of sizes, styles and materials available, you can find a canopy that complements your home's exterior while at the same time offering functional advantages.

Overdoor/Porch Canopies Ballingry

The Main Benefits of Porch/Overdoor Canopies:

  1. Sun Protection: The shade provided by canopies from the sun's intense UV rays is essential in preventing your door, particularly if it's wooden, from warping and fading. This feature also offers a cool area for you and your guests during hot days, preventing any discomfort while the door is being unlocked.
  2. A Reduction in Maintenance: Canopies serve to protect your doorway from rain and snow, cutting down on the need for continual cleaning. They also offer protection to your door from dust, leaves, and different forms of debris, which helps in extending its lifespan.
  3. Shelter for Packages and Deliveries: Deliveries and parcels are shielded from rain and snow damage through the covered space provided by overdoor canopies.
  4. Greater Security: A well-lit overdoor canopy can deter potential intruders by illuminating the entrance area, making it much less appealing for nocturnal trespassers.
  5. Enhanced Kerb Appeal: Imagine an inviting entrance that exudes elegance and sophistication. This is the power of a thoughtfully chosen canopy! Framing your doorway, it draws the eye and creates a warm, welcoming ambiance for anyone approaching your property in Ballingry.
  6. Protection from the Weather: Sheltering your porch and doorway area from rain, snow and hail, canopies prevent these areas from becoming hazardous and slippery. This safeguards you and your visitors, maintaining dryness upon exiting or entering your home, most notably in harsh weather.

Your home's exterior is given a practical and stylish upgrade with the addition of porch/overdoor canopies. Offering protection from the weather, they give a boost to kerb appeal and may also enhance your property's security. You can establish a welcoming entrance that enhances your Ballingry property with both beauty and functionality by opting for the suitable size, material and style. Bear in mind that maintaining your canopy well can result in it lasting for several years, making it a a worthwhile, long-lasting investment in your dwelling.

Lean-To Porch Ballingry

A popular choice for homes in Ballingry, a lean-to porch has a sloping roof that can be designed to match the roof of your house, or tie in with an existing canopy or awning. Lean-to porches are an efficacious, yet relatively low-cost way to improve the front of your house. A lean-to porch this is completely enclosed will provide shade from the sun, save energy by providing insulation to your front entryway, add an extra layer of security to your home and create a useful extra space for keeping hats, shoes and coats.

Just as effective on either the back, side or front of your property, lean-to porches are among the easiest ways to extend your home in Ballingry. A lean-to porch can be open to the elements, partially enclosed or completely enclosed, dependant upon your particular specifications. Lean-to porches can actually be as basic as four wooden posts holding up an inclined roof. Nowadays, you can even purchase lean-to porch kits, if you fancy testing your DIY skills. The Federation of Master Builders

Regarded with high esteem, the Federation of Master Builders (FMB) serves as a trade association in the UK construction industry. It serves as a platform for professional builders, advocating for high standards of craftsmanship, customer service and integrity. Adherence to a strict Code of Practice is required of FMB members, who undergo an exacting vetting process. The FMB provides resources and support to its members, helping them stay updated on industry best practices and regulations. Those in Ballingry who enlist the help of FMB members can have confidence in their expertise and professionalism. Additionally, the Federation of Master Builders provides a dispute resolution service to address any problems that may arise during a construction project.

Evolving from its inception in the 1940's, the Federation of Master Builders has grown into a distinguished trade organisation, symbolizing numerous construction businesses and professionals right across the United Kingdom. Maintaining a legacy that covers more than seven decades, the FMB persists in its essential function of influencing the construction landscape and preserving the highest levels of workmanship.

Skip Hire Ballingry

Whatever the size of your porch project in Ballingry it will probably produce a fair amount of waste and rubbish which will not be appropriate for general disposal in your household bins. Most local councils also insist that the disposal of any garden or building materials must be done in a managed and eco-friendly way. This could mean you're required to get rid of it in an official recycling and waste disposal centre. Instead of going through the aggravation of continual trips to the local council tip, you could look into renting a skip, and bung your rubbish in there.

Skip Hire Ballingry

By using a specialist skip hire company in Ballingry, you'll be given assurances that your waste is going to be delivered to a certified facility, and will be disposed of correctly and safely. You must go over what sort of waste materials will be created by speaking to the builder who's carrying out your porch extension project, and the skip hire service who'll be collecting your waste. For example if asbestos might be involved, it may mean that the skip hire firm will need to divide dangerous waste into a totally separate disposal system.

Understandably, there are strict rules for dealing with hazardous waste and it's best to leave it to the professionals to handle. To make sure that all regulations are addressed properly, both your builder and the skip hire service will work closely together.

If you happen to have a space where a skip can be positioned in your drive or garden, that is a perfect scenario. You'll need a space for the skip someplace close to your work area, and if you have only got parking on the main road or no garden area that's suitable you could get hold of your nearest neighbours and ask if they can help. On some highways in Ballingry which have permit parking you may need to speak to the local authorities who issue permits for a short-term permit appropriate for construction work. You can then be reassured that there won't be any issues with the positioning of your skip.
